Converting mmol to moles
In chemistry, the mole is a unit of measurement for the amount of a substance. It is defined as the amount of a substance that contains 6.022 × 10^23 particles of that substance. The millimole (mmol) is a smaller unit of measurement equal to one thousandth of a mole.
To convert mmol to moles, you can use the following formula:
mmol / 1000 = moles
For example, to convert 10 mmol to moles, you would use the following equation:
10 mmol / 1000 = 0.01 moles
Here are some examples of how to convert mmol to moles:
10 mmol = 0.01 moles 100 mmol = 0.1 moles 1000 mmol = 1 moles
